When installing J-channel at roof-to-wall intersections, it is recommended to install it at approximately 1/2 inch above the roof line. Chalk a straight line on roof flashing to guide the installation. The depth of the J-channel required depends on the profile of the panel being installed. Clear conceal trim can be used in place of J-channel around doors, windows, and other projections. It should be fastened every 10 to 12 inches. J-channel is used as a receiver around all windrows, doors, projections, corners, and under all eaves, soffits, and gable ends. The circular saw should have a blade designed for vinyl or a fine tooth blade installed in the reverse direction. Panels may be cut with snips or a circular saw. Note that face nailing may cause ripples of buckles in the siding because the siding cannot move as it expands and contracts.
Allow a clearance of about 1/32 inch.ĭrive the nail straight and level to prevent any restriction of the panel. So the panels can expand and contract with temperature changes, you must not drive the nails too tightly against the nail hem. Then, fasten the top of the new panel to the wall. The panels should not be under tension or compression when they are fastened.It should drop slightly and rest on the panel below it. Finally, release pressure on the new panel. then push up from the bottom until the lock id fully engaged with the piece below it. Install each new panel by aligning it with the previous course.When installing the panels, leave a minimum of 1/4 inch clearance at all openings and stops to allow for normal expansion and contraction.The nails must be long enough to penetrate the substrate by a minimum of 3/4 inch. Use nails with a 3/8 inch head, and a 1/8 inch shank.

Comply with any and all local building code requirements.įoundry vinyl siding comes in five foot lengths that is fastened to the wall along a nailing hem. Be sure to follow the manufacturers installation requirements for all underlayment and any other applications.

Work should be performed in a safe, professional manner. Note that flashing should always extend past the nail flanges of any accessories to prevent water infiltration.Īs with any siding job, perform the work only when existing weather and forecast permits.
